For three months, a Swiss art project titled "The Random Darknet Shopper" has had $100 in Bitcoins to spend per week and has used the virtual currency to buy random products off the Darknet.
Now, after purchasing 10 ecstasy tablets and a bogus Hungarian passport scan (among other things), that Darknet-surfing robot's shopping has been confiscated.
The London-based Swiss artists !Mediengruppe Bitnik - Domagoj Smoljo and Carmen Weisskopf - behind the project said on their blog that on 12 January, the day after the exhibition in Switzerland closed,  the public prosecutor's office of St. Gallen seized and sealed their work with the purpose of "[impeding] an endangerment of third parties through the drugs exhibited by destroying them."
